I am aware the M24 has a fixed Leupold Mk 4 10X scope, but was it ever issued or changed in the field for a higher power scope? My Club is establishing an issue sniper rifle class of competition. I have the Leuold Mk 4 10X but wondering about an acceptable higher power scope.
 
The rules used by the Quantico Shooting Club are a good guide for the match you are describing (3 categories: vintage/re-1953, Vietnam, and Modern). Scopes are limited to 10 or 12 power in the modern category, to the best of my knowledge.


As to your question: US Army (aka Big Army) M24s used 10x scopes circa 1988-2010.

SOCOM/Special Operations M24s may have used some different scopes like the super rare 4.5-14x Leupold FFP scope seen on an Army Ranger M24 with MIRS rail back in 2009, and some Leupold 3.5-10x scopes were used, but the Army didn’t move to the higher 6.5-20x magnification Leupold scope until they adopted the 300 WinMag via the XM2010 program - to the best of my knowledge. That said, could a Leupold 4.5-14x scope on the big Barnett 50 BMG rifle have been removed and installed on an M24 somewhere in Iraq or Afghanistan? Yes, as a ad hoc and/or temporary set-up, but they were not issued that way.

I strongly suggest the match rules limit magnification to 10x (or 12x for M40A5s) to keep guys from showing up with “fantasy sniper” rifles with huge 42x power NightForce scopes or other crazy stuff. The Quantico Shooting Club posted the rules I showed in that link b/c that’s what happened the first year. Guys brought out their 1000 yard F-class rifle to ‘compete’ against vintage sniper rifles with their correct(ish) 10x scopes...
